@charset "UTF-8";

/* 製品一覧用CSS　ichiranAA.css */

body{
font-family: 'Lucida Grande','Hiragino Kaku Gothic ProN',
 Meiryo, sans-serif;
}

article{
margin:-10px auto;
}



/*-----------------------------------------------------------
                       ヘッダー　                              
--------------------------------------------------------------*/



#AAnavi{

width:120%;
height:85px;

background-color:#FFFFFF;
position:fixed;
margin:-10px;

border-bottom:1px solid #d8d8ff;
}




#Anavi{

width:980px;
height:85px;

left:50%;
margin-left:-490px;
margin-top:-10px;
list-style-type:none;
background-color:#FFFFFF;
margin-bottom:-10px;
position:fixed;
}



li{
display: inline;
}




.navi{

padding-left:0;
list-style-type:none;

margin:0 auto;

width:980px;
height:85px;
}




.navi li{

float:left;
width:163px;
height:85px;


background-color:#ffffff;
}


.navi li a{
display: block;
font-size:17px;

padding:1.8em 0 0 1px; /*メニューを中央に表示*/

text-decoration: none;
text-align:center;

margin-top:10px;


border-right:0.5px solid #f8f8ff;
border-left:0.5px solid #f8f8ff;
border-bottom:1px solid #8888df;

width:162px;
height:54px; /*メニュー縦線*/

display: -moz-inline-box;
display: inline-block;
*display: inline;
*zoom: 1;

}




.navi li a:hover{
background-color:#f0f0f7;
border-bottom:2px solid #8c0000;
color:#8c0000;

}

#topVisualWrapper{
height:200px;
margin:10px -20px 0 -20px;
}


.topVisualWrapper2{
height:200px;
background-image:url("img/HEAD1-1.jpg"); 
padding-top:40px;
-moz-background-size:100% auto;
background-size:100% auto;
background-repeat: no-repeat;
}


.topVisual{
width:980px;
height:200px;

margin: 0 auto;
}



.topCopyWrapper{
float:left;
}




.topCopy{
font-size:40px;
color:#000057;
margin-top:60px;
z-index: 15;

font-family:"游明朝", YuMincho,
 "ヒラギノ明朝 ProN W3", 
"Hiragino Mincho ProN", 
"HG明朝E", 
"ＭＳ Ｐ明朝", 
"ＭＳ 明朝", serif;

}



.F{
font-size:15px;
color:#000057;

margin-top:2%;
margin-left:2%;
z-index: 15;
}

/*-----------------------------------------------------
                   コンテンツ右側                  
---------------------------------------------------------*/

.contentsRight{
margin-top: 50px;
margin-right:10px;
float:right;

width:420px;
z-index: 11;

}


.contact{
width:400px;
margin:30px 10px 10px 10px;
z-index: 13;
}


#toContact1{
border:solid 1px #COCOCO;
width:300px;
height:50px;
font-size:15px;

}

textarea,input,select{
background-color:transparent;
}

/*-------------------------------------------------
               コンテンツ右側終了                  
-------------------------------------------------*/

/*-------------------------------------------------　
                   ヘッダー終わり　
------------------------------------------------------*/




/*----------------------------------------------------
                         製品一覧                         
-----------------------------------------------------*/

.naiyouWrapper{
width:980px;
margin:0 auto;

}


.naiyou1{
padding-bottom:10px;
}


.naiyou2{

padding-bottom:10px;
margin-bottom:18px;
overflow:auto;
font-size:15px;
}



.line{
border-bottom: 4px solid #8e0000;
width:100%;
/*padding: 10px;*/
}


h2{
font-size:30px;
font-weight: normal;
color:#000057;
text-align:left;

}


.T span{
font-size:18px;
margin-left:275px;
/*float:right;*/
}



img.img1{
float:left;
}



.name{
font-size:18px;
}


.name a:hover{
color:#8c0000;
}


/*-----------------------------------------------------
                    製品一覧終わり                     
-------------------------------------------------------*/


/*---------------------------------------------
                   フッター　                  
--------------------------------------------------*/

footer{
height:200px;
margin:10px -20px auto -20px;


background-image:url("img/GAZOU3-3-3.jpg");
clear:both; /* フッター最下部に */


-moz-background-size:100% auto;
background-size:100% auto;
}	




.footerWrapper{
width:980px;
height:100px;
margin:0 auto;
padding-top:0;



}



.footerUE{
width:300px;
height:100px;
padding-top:20px;
float:left;

}


.footerUE2{
border-right:1px solid #8c8c8c;

}



.footer-navi{
list-style-type:none;
font-size:14px;

}



.footer-navi a{
text-decoration:none;

}



.footer-navi a:hover{
text-decoration:underline;
color:#8c0000;
}



.footerSHITA{
width:320px;
height:100px;
float:left;

padding-left:40px;
padding-top:50px;
}



.renraku{
font-size:20px;

}



#toContact2{
border:solid 1px #COCOCO;
width:230px;
height:40px;
font-size:18px;

font-family: 'Lucida Grande','Hiragino Kaku Gothic ProN',
Meiryo, sans-serif;
}




textarea,input,select{
background-color:transparent;
}




.footerJ{
width:320px;
height:100px;
float:left;

padding-bottom:40px;
}


.footerR{


font-size:35px;
color:#000057;

font-family:"游明朝", YuMincho,
 "ヒラギノ明朝 ProN W3", 
"Hiragino Mincho ProN", 
"HG明朝E", 
"ＭＳ Ｐ明朝", 
"ＭＳ 明朝", serif;

}


.F2{
font-size:15px;

margin-top:2%;
margin-left:3%;

}




.footer2{
height:4px;
background-color:#e0e0e0;
text-align: right;

position:bottom;
vertical-align: auto;
/*margin:0 -20px auto -20px;*/
clear:both;
padding-top:20px;

}


.foot{
width:980px;
margin:-20px auto;

clear:both;
}


/*-------------------------------------------------------------
                          フッター終わり                       
-------------------------------------------------------------*/
